Randy Dunlap wrote:
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v4/fib_frontend.c: In function 'fib_net_init':
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v4/fib_frontend.c:1024: error: implicit declaration of function 'fib_proc_init'
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v4/fib_frontend.c: In function 'fib_net_exit':
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v4/fib_frontend.c:1039: error: implicit declaration of function 'fib_proc_exit'
>
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v6/sysctl_net_ipv6.c: In function 'ipv6_sysctl_net_init':
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v6/sysctl_net_ipv6.c:71: error: implicit declaration of function 'ipv6_route_sysctl_init'
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v6/sysctl_net_ipv6.c:71: warning: assignment makes pointer from integer without a cast
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v6/sysctl_net_ipv6.c:75: error: implicit declaration of function 'ipv6_icmp_sysctl_init'
> linux-2.6.24-git6/net/ipv6/sysctl_net_ipv6.c:75: warning: assignment makes pointer from integer without a cast
>
>
> config attached.
>
> ---
> ~Randy
Hi,
thanks for catching this. I sent a fix for these two compilation errors
a few days ago. I guess they will be merged very soon by Dave.
